The English Standard Version or ESV is a conservative Protestant update of the 1971 RSV, published in 2001. In conservative Protestant circles, it has gained some ground among people who might earlier have used the NIV or NKJV. Due to its sectarian nature, it hasn't really caught on in mainstream Protestantism or in academia. There, the nrsv of 1989[1] occupies an analogous position.

There is a belief out there -- I don't know how accurate it is -- that the ESV is a uniquely Calvinism-friendly translation. On acocunt of this, an old roommate of mine jokingly refered to the ESV as the Elect Standard Version.
